2026-04-23bpf: Introduce bpf register BPF_REG_PARAMSYonghong Song
Introduce BPF_REG_PARAMS as a dedicated BPF register for stack argument accesses. It occupies the BPF register number 11 (R11), which is used as the base pointer for the stack argument area, keeping it separate from the R10-based (BPF_REG_FP) program stack. The kernel-internal hidden register BPF_REG_AX previously occupied slot 11 (MAX_BPF_REG). With BPF_REG_PARAMS taking that slot, BPF_REG_AX moves to slot 12 and MAX_BPF_EXT_REG increases accordingly. 2026-04-23bpf: Fix tail_call_reachable leakYonghong Song
In check_max_stack_depth_subprog(), the local variable tail_call_reachable is set when entering a callee that has a tail call, but never reset when popping back to the parent. This causes the flag to leak across sibling subprogs in the DFS traversal. This results in unnecessary JIT overhead: the JIT emits tail call counter preservation code for subprogs that can never be reached via a tail call path. Fix this by resetting tail_call_reachable to the parent's actual per-subprog flag when popping a frame. If the parent was already marked tail_call_reachable by a previous sibling's traversal, the local variable stays true. Otherwise it resets to false, so subsequent siblings start with a clean state. 2026-04-23xen/privcmd: fix double free via VMA splittingJuergen Gross
privcmd_vm_ops defines .close (privcmd_close), but neither .may_split nor .open. When userspace does a partial munmap() on a privcmd mapping, the kernel splits the VMA via __split_vma(). Since may_split is NULL, the split is allowed. vm_area_dup() copies vm_private_data (a pages array allocated in alloc_empty_pages()) into the new VMA without any fixup, because there is no .open callback. Both VMAs now point to the same pages array. When the unmapped portion is closed, privcmd_close() calls: - xen_unmap_domain_gfn_range() - xen_free_unpopulated_pages() - kvfree(pages) The surviving VMA still holds the dangling pointer. When it is later destroyed, the same sequence runs again, which leads to a double free. Fix this issue by adding a .may_split callback denying the VMA split. This is XSA-487 / CVE-2026-31787 Fixes: d71f513985c2 ("xen: privcmd: support autotranslated physmap guests.") 2026-04-23Buffer overflow in drivers/xen/sys-hypervisor.cJuergen Gross
The build id returned by HYPERVISOR_xen_version(XENVER_build_id) is neither NUL terminated nor a string. The first causes a buffer overflow as sprintf in buildid_show will read and copy till it finds a NUL. 00000000 f4 91 51 f4 dd 38 9e 9d 65 47 52 eb 10 71 db 50 |..Q..8..eGR..q.P| 00000010 b9 a8 01 42 6f 2e 32 |...Bo.2| 00000017 So use a memcpy instead of sprintf to have the correct value: 00000000 f4 91 51 f4 dd 00 9e 9d 65 47 52 eb 10 71 db 50 |..Q.....eGR..q.P| 00000010 b9 a8 01 42 |...B| 00000014 (the above have a hack to embed a zero inside and check it's returned correctly). 2026-04-23mptcp: sync the msk->sndbuf at accept() timeGang Yan
On passive MPTCP connections, the msk sndbuf is not updated correctly. The root cause is an order issue in the accept path: - tcp_check_req() -> subflow_syn_recv_sock() -> mptcp_sk_clone_init() calls __mptcp_propagate_sndbuf() to copy the ssk sndbuf into msk - Later, tcp_child_process() -> tcp_init_transfer() -> tcp_sndbuf_expand() grows the ssk sndbuf. So __mptcp_propagate_sndbuf() runs before the ssk sndbuf has been expanded and the msk ends up with a much smaller sndbuf than the subflow: MPTCP: msk->sndbuf:20480, msk->first->sndbuf:2626560 Fix this by moving the __mptcp_propagate_sndbuf() call from mptcp_sk_clone_init() -- the ssk sndbuf is not yet finalized there -- to __mptcp_propagate_sndbuf() at accept() time, when the ssk sndbuf has been fully expanded by tcp_sndbuf_expand(). 2026-04-23vsock/virtio: fix MSG_ZEROCOPY pinned-pages accountingStefano Garzarella
virtio_transport_init_zcopy_skb() uses iter->count as the size argument for msg_zerocopy_realloc(), which in turn passes it to mm_account_pinned_pages() for RLIMIT_MEMLOCK accounting. However, this function is called after virtio_transport_fill_skb() has already consumed the iterator via __zerocopy_sg_from_iter(), so on the last skb, iter->count will be 0, skipping the RLIMIT_MEMLOCK enforcement. Pass pkt_len (the total bytes being sent) as an explicit parameter to virtio_transport_init_zcopy_skb() instead of reading the already-consumed iter->count. This matches TCP and UDP, which both call msg_zerocopy_realloc() with the original message size. 2026-04-23net: mana: Guard mana_remove against double invocationErni Sri Satya Vennela
If PM resume fails (e.g., mana_attach() returns an error), mana_probe() calls mana_remove(), which tears down the device and sets gd->gdma_context = NULL and gd->driver_data = NULL. However, a failed resume callback does not automatically unbind the driver. When the device is eventually unbound, mana_remove() is invoked a second time. Without a NULL check, it dereferences gc->dev with gc == NULL, causing a kernel panic. Add an early return if gdma_context or driver_data is NULL so the second invocation is harmless. Move the dev = gc->dev assignment after the guard so it cannot dereference NULL. 2026-04-23netconsole: avoid out-of-bounds access on empty string in trim_newline()Breno Leitao
trim_newline() unconditionally dereferences s[len - 1] after computing len = strnlen(s, maxlen). When the string is empty, len is 0 and the expression underflows to s[(size_t)-1], reading (and potentially writing) one byte before the buffer. The two callers feed trim_newline() with the result of strscpy() from configfs store callbacks (dev_name_store, userdatum_value_store). configfs guarantees count >= 1 reaches the callback, but the byte itself can be NUL: a userspace write(fd, "\0", 1) leaves the destination empty after strscpy() and triggers the underflow. The OOB write only fires if the adjacent byte happens to be '\n', so this is not a security issue, but the access is undefined behaviour either way. This pattern is commonly flagged by LLM-based code reviewers. While it is not a security fix, the underlying access is undefined behaviour and the change is small and self-contained, so it is a reasonable candidate for the stable trees. Guard the dereference on a non-zero length.
